When must crew members refrain from going between uncoupled locomotives or cars?

Explanation:
Crew members must refrain from going between uncoupled locomotives or cars when the clearance is less than 50 feet because this distance poses a significant risk of being caught between the equipment. Clearances of less than 50 feet can indicate that the likelihood of movement from another train or an issue with the air brake system could occur without warning, which could lead to serious injuries or fatalities. By adhering to this safety standard, crew members help ensure a safer work environment. Other situations that could be unsafe, such as unclear conditions at night or personal judgment about safety, do not provide the same level of concrete safety guidance as the defined distance of clearance. Safe practices rely on established rules, like the specified clearance measurement, that mitigate risks associated with working around railroad equipment.
